(13) Mounting the oil seal and gear case cover
1) Replace the used oil seal with a new one when the
gear case cover is disassembled.
2) Insert a new oil seal by using the oil seal insertion
tool on the position of the gear case cover end face
(65 0/-1 mm distance from the end of the cylinder
block). (Refer to the right figure.)
3) Apply lithium grease to the oil seal lips.
4) When wear is found on the oil seal contact part of a
crankshaft pulley, replace the pulley with a new
one.
Carefully install the pulley so as not to
damage the oil seal.
5) Apply the liquid gasket to the gear case cover.
Position the two knock pins and tighten the bolts of
the gear case cover.
NOTE:
Trim the liquid gasket if it protrudes onto the oil pan
mounting surface.
(14) Mounting the lube oil inlet pipe
Mount the lube oil inlet pipe on the bottom of the
cylinder block, using new gasket.
